7/2/2013 1 Comment Phil D'ath, RIPSad news at lunch time today of the passing of old boy and past staff member Phil D'ath. Phil passed away this morning after a long and valiant battle against illness and we know that all old boys will keep both Phil and his family in their thoughts and prayers.
Phil attended FDMC in the middle 1960's before leaving to pursue a career in carpentry. In the 1980's and 90's Phil had several tours of duty as a workshop teacher at the College, finally returning to the "real world" in 2004. Phil was a great supporter of FDMC and an individual who could always be relied on to speak his mind and then just get on with things. He will be greatly missed by his large family and circle of friends.
